Asahi India Glass' revenue increased 11.2% YoY
  • 31 Jan 2026
  • Asahi India Glass Ltd reported a 9.0% quarter-on-quarter (QoQ) increase in its consolidated revenues for the quarter-ended Dec (Q3 FY 2025-26). On a year-on-year (YoY) basis, it witnessed a growth of 11.2%.
  • Its expenses for the quarter were up by 2.8% QoQ and 8.9% YoY.
  • The net profit increased 70.9% QoQ and decreased 4.8% YoY.
  • The earnings per share (EPS) of Asahi India Glass Ltd stood at 3.9 during Q3 FY 2025-26.

Asahi India Glass Ltd is a prominent player in the glass manufacturing industry, primarily engaged in the production and supply of glass products. The company specializes in manufacturing a wide range of glass solutions catering to various sectors, including automotive and architectural. Known for its high-quality glass products, Asahi India Glass Ltd has established a substantial market presence both domestically and internationally. During the third quarter of the fiscal year 2026 (Q3FY26), Asahi India Glass Ltd reported a total income of ₹1266.39 crores. This marks a 9.0% increase from the previous quarter (Q2FY26), where the total income stood at ₹1162.15 crores. Additionally, there was an 11.2% year-over-year (YoY) growth compared to the third quarter of fiscal year 2025 (Q3FY25), which had a total income of ₹1138.70 crores. In Q3FY26, Asahi India Glass Ltd achieved a profit before tax (PBT) of ₹132.93 crores, which is a significant improvement of 87.8% quarter-over-quarter (QoQ) from ₹70.77 crores in Q2FY26. However, on a year-over-year basis, PBT decreased by 5.7% from Q3FY25's figure of ₹140.91 crores. The tax expense for Q3FY26 was ₹33.36 crores, showing a substantial increase of 169.5% QoQ from ₹12.38 crores in Q2FY26, but a decrease of 7.0% YoY from ₹35.86 crores in Q3FY25. Profit after tax (PAT) for Q3FY26 was ₹99.47 crores, up 70.9% QoQ from ₹58.19 crores in Q2FY26, yet a slight decrease of 4.8% YoY from ₹104.54 crores in Q3FY25. The earnings per share (EPS) in Q3FY26 was ₹3.90, reflecting a QoQ increase of 75.7% from ₹2.22 in Q2FY26, but a YoY decline of 10.1% from ₹4.34 in Q3FY25. The total expenses for Asahi India Glass Ltd in Q3FY26 amounted to ₹1121.47 crores, which represents a 2.8% increase QoQ from ₹1091.38 crores in Q2FY26 and an 8.9% rise YoY from ₹1029.62 crores in Q3FY25. This increase in expenses is consistent with the rise in total income, indicating that the company has managed its cost structure alongside revenue growth.
